The focus of this book is on performance optimization in Wireless Sensor Networks (WSNs), aimed at achieving, through proper design of physical and Medium Access Control (MAC) layers, energy savings and/or increased throughput. Four scenarios of interest are considered: (i) WSNs for target detection in surveillance applications; (ii) power allocation strategies for WSN lifetime maximization; (iii) throughput and lifetime maximization in clustered WSNs; and (iv) integration of radio control technology (namely, RFID) in Zigbee WSNs for high energy efficiency. In each scenario, an analytical model for performance characterization is presented, together with simulation results.
